Capture of Tarapur Fort by Chimaji Appa 25.01.2020

January 24, 1739 On this date Chimaji Appa, the brother of Baji Rao, defeated the Portuguese forces and captured the fort here, a significant event in many ways. While many know about Baji Rao, not many have an idea about his equally great brother Chimaji Appa, who played a vital role on West Coast. Often overshadowed by his more famous brother, he was as brilliant and great a warrior.

Shaheed Udham Singh 26.12.2019

Udham Singh, was a revolutionary belonging to the GhadarParty best known for his assassination in London of Michael O' Dwyer, the former lieutenant governor of the Punjab in India, on 13 March 1940. The assassination was in revenge for the Jallianwala Baghmassacre in Amritsar in 1919.
